What are the best tires on the market for a Subaru Outback?

This past summer my wife and I invested in a brand new 2022 Subaru Outback Premium. We’ve heard nothing but good things about it, and so far we love this car a lot. But eventually we’ll need to replace the tires, so what should we get? What are the best tires for a Subaru Outback?

There’s a seemingly endless list of tires to choose from for this car, whether you have the 17” 225/65R17 or 18” 225/60R18 tires. Your Premium has the 17” wheels, by the way, along with the top-tier Wilderness trim.
Here are some of the most popular options Subaru Outback aficionados tend to suggest in Outback forums—this is a question that tends to come up a lot in these subie groups:
  • Falken Wildpeak A/T Trail
  • Michelin Defender T+H
  • Michelin Defender LTX
  • Michelin Latitude Tour HP
  • Pirelli Scorpion ATR
  • Continental Pro Contact TX
  • Cooper Endeavor Plus
Despite the Outback being virtually unstoppable in the snow, we strongly recommend investing in winter tires, especially if you live in areas where plowing isn’t common. Here are a few suggestions:
  • Bridgestone Blizzak WS90
  • Michelin X-Ice
  • Pirelli Scorpion Winter
Here’s an important disclaimer that not every Subaru dealership warns owners about, though they should: apart from the RWD Subaru BRZ, every Subaru model has a symmetrical all-wheel drive (AWD) system. You need to replace all four tires on these cars at once, unlike most other cars. It can goof up your AWD if you don’t.
